This concrete boat ramp in Omro provides convenient access to Lake Butte des Morts, a large 8,800-acre recreational lake in Winnebago County. The single-lane concrete ramp is suitable for launching boats up to 22 feet in length, making it accessible for most recreational watercraft. The launch site serves as a good entry point for kayakers, canoeists, and powerboaters exploring this popular fishing and recreation destination.
Lake Butte des Morts is a shallow lake with a maximum depth of 9 feet, which influences water conditions and navigation. The lake supports a healthy fishery including walleye, northern pike, largemouth and smallmouth bass, panfish, musky, sturgeon, and catfish. Paddlers should be aware that as a shallow lake, wind conditions can create choppy water fairly quickly. The lake offers ample recreational boating opportunities, and this Omro ramp serves as one of several public access points around the lake for launching your vessel.
